Fat free french fries (chips)

For many people chips or french fries are a staple acompaniment to meals, but when you're trying to lose weight they have to be banned. Not any more. These scrummy no fat chips are a delight can be eaten on a daily basis without guilt!

Ingredients

1/2 butternut squash
salt

Method

Pre-heat oven to 425*f, 200*c gas mark 6. 

Peel and de-seed the butternut squash (you'll need a sharp knife to cut them). 

Slice it in half and cut it into french fry shapes. You can use a crinkle cutter if you like, but they'll work any way you slice 'em. 

Place on a cookie sheet (baking tray) sprayed with non-stick spray. 

Cover lightly with salt. 

Place tray in your pre-heated oven and bake for 40 minutes or so, turning halfway through the baking time. 

Fries are done when they start to brown and go crispy on the edges.

Serve with ketchup or salt and vinegar
  
Serving Size:  5 oz., uncooked
Calories:  65
Fat: 0g
